Ordinals
beta
Address bc1qkcf97cyv4d9lluzk4pdwc6cfhd60spn8t388re
sat balance
131576
runes balances
outputs
c1c1b67fbf124274ca2c319682b1d2e96aa07cd014e8750e2876174869d07544:0